    eslint-plugin-vue

    eslint-plugin-vue

    ESLint plugin for Vue.js

    ...Be aware that depending on the code samples you write in tests, the RuleTester parser property must be set accordingly (this can be done on a test-by-test basis). The default JavaScript parser must be replaced because Vue.js single file components are not plain JavaScript, but a custom file format. vue-eslint-parser is a replacement parser that generates an enhanced AST with nodes that represent specific parts of the template syntax, as well as the contents of the script tag.

    browserify

    browserify

    browser-side require() the node.js way

    ...With Browserify you can write code that uses require in the same way that you would use it in Node. Install the uniq module with npm. Now recursively bundle up all the required modules starting at main.js into a single file called bundle.js with the browserify command. Browserify parses the AST for require() calls to traverse the entire dependency graph of your project. Drop a single <script> tag into your html and you're done! browserify is a tool for compiling node-flavored commonjs modules for the browser. You can use browserify to organize your code and use third-party libraries even if you don't use node itself in any other capacity except for bundling and installing packages with npm.

    offline-plugin for webpack

    offline-plugin for webpack

    Offline plugin (ServiceWorker, AppCache) for webpack

    This plugin is intended to provide an offline experience for webpack projects. It uses ServiceWorker, and AppCache as a fallback under the hood. Simply include this plugin in your webpack.config, and the accompanying runtime in your client script, and your project will become offline ready by caching all (or some) of the webpack output assets.

    Docs Online Viewer

    Docs Online Viewer

    Easily open documents/files of any format you found on the web

    Docs Online Viewer is a Firefox add-on that allows you to easily open documents/files of any format you found on the web (PDF, DOC, DOCX, XLS, PPT, RTF, ODT, ODP, CSV etc.) using Google Docs and Zoho Viewer. This way, Docs Online Viewer eliminates the need to open online docs in an external application. Docs Online Viewer is cross-platform and it works on Mac OS X, Windows and Linux.
